Trying again

On January 31st, I told myself I was going to lose 30 pounds in an effort to psyche myself into a diet. I ended up losing 13 pounds, which is still a feat for me.

I could not have done this without the slow progress I’d made in recent months. Previously, I had stopped getting fast food altogether since I came home from New York (beginning of November 2010) and from there tried to sneak in as many meals that revolved around veggies as possible.

When I finally said to myself, “I’m ready to do this.” I started using my Loseit.com app every day to track all the food I was eating and being accountable to myself. Even that accountability took a slow path to realization as I began writing in my WordPress.com blog daily. Just being mindful of what I put in my mouth is a step in the right direction and help keeps me honest.

I’m proud of the progress I’ve made, though I’m not anywhere close to the weight I’d like, but for once in a long, long while, I’m finally on the right track.
